This market refers to the tennis match between Alexandre Muller and Coleman Wong in the Cancun, originally scheduled for August 18, 2026 at 12:00PM ET. This market will resolve to 'Alexandre Muller' if Alexandre Muller advances against Coleman Wong. This market will resolve to 'Coleman Wong' if Coleman Wong advances against Alexandre Muller. If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50. If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ances. If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50. The primary resolution source will be official information from the ATP Tour. A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
Alexandre Muller faces rising Hong Kong talent Coleman Wong in the Cancun Challenger round of 32 on hard courts. Wong enters with strong momentum after claiming his maiden Challenger title earlier in 2026, reaching an ATP semifinal in Los Cabos with upsets over higher-ranked opponents, and advancing deep in Hong Kong events. Muller, a former top-40 player now ranked around 136, has posted just an 11-18 record this season amid an extended slump. The pair has no prior head-to-head history. Wong’s recent consistency and ranking trajectory position him as the more in-form competitor, though Muller’s experience on the surface could influence tight sets in this first-round matchup.
